Unpaid work experience

1_234589 [Edit] [Delete] 17:31, 28 August '13

0 replies, etc...but how do people feel about unpaid work experience?

Triggered by receiving an email from a well-respected organisation advertising for students to do unpaid advocacy work for them.

The 'job description' says they're required to: promote the organisation through digital means, plan events, write copy, do research, and distribute flyers. All work which normally would require them to employ someone, surely?

Although they only want a few hours a week, the implication that it's recurring work seems to differentiate it from traditional work experience opportunities (which is normally limited to only a few weeks to a month). Instead of payment they're offering a few tickets to events and the potential to make key industry contacts.

Surely this sort of thing should be paid at minimum wage, no?
